Who was Freya in Merlin?

Freya was a Druid girl who fell in love with Merlin, who she met when he helped her to escape from the bounty hunter Halig. She later died on the shores of the Lake of Avalon, after which she became the Lady of the Lake.

Who is Freya in Arthur?

Laura Donnelly
The ninth episode of the season 2 is titled “The Lady of the Lake”, wherein a sorceress named Freya, played by Laura Donnelly, dies and vows to repay Merlin for his kindness to her. In the season 3 finale, Freya, now a water spirit, gives Excalibur to Merlin so that he can give it to Prince Arthur Pendragon.

Where was Merlin buried?

A Wiltshire mound where the legendary wizard Merlin was purported to be buried has been found to date back to 2400 BC. Radiocarbon dating tests were carried out on charcoal samples taken from Marlborough Mound, which lies in Marlborough College’s grounds.

When does Merlin first see Freya?

Merlin first sees Freya. Sometime after she was cast out of the Druid’s camp, Freya was captured by the bounty hunter Halig and taken to Camelot. Halig intended to turn her over to Uther for money, as the king was known to offer a handsome reward for anyone with magic.
